2014 Vauxhall Meriva facelift (pictured) gets new diesel engine It’s more than three years since the Vauxhall Meriva arrived – at Geneva in 2010 – as Vauxhall’s compact people carrier, so it’s time for a bit of a titivate and a few updates. The cosmetic makeover for the 2014 MY Meriva isn’t huge, but Vauxhall has thrown in a new grill and new headlights to fulfil the ‘new nose’ requirements of a facelift, there’s new alloys and new alloy options and daytime running lights. But the biggest change comes under the skin, with the old 1.7 litre turbo diesel being supplanted by the new 1.6 litre from the Zafira which offers 134bhp and 236lb/ft of torque.

News of David Lyon's shock departure from General Motors broke this weekend. Lyon was set to become Vice President of Design for Opel/Vauxhall in Rüsselsheim, Germany on 1 August. Up until now, he was responsible for Buick and GMC design, GM interior design and global cross brand design.

Concept Car of the Week: Toyota EX-1 (1969)

Back in the 60s, Toyota launched a few iconic sports cars such as the 800 and the gorgeous 2000 GT. Not happy to have created automotive perfection with the latter, the Japanese brand went on to explore even more extravagant shapes and unveiled the first of the EX concepts series in 1969. While its bold lines are truly Japanese, the EX-1 looked like the missing link between the fast silhouette of a 1967 Maserati Ghibli and the hairy-chested heft of a Dodge Challenger.
